Yep. I’d say if you take the tasks seriously you have around 80-100 hours of total gameplay.

If you get held up with building and gathering, your game time will never end… Depends on the scale of your projects.

There are currently 5 bosses in the game. There will be 9 when it fully releases i think.

That’s 4 more tiers of unlockables that come with killing each of the bosses so the game should more than double in stuff to do by the time it comes out of Early Access.

Its a fun game and would definitely recommend, however once you beat the second boss in the swamps the game kind of gets really easy especially after you can make weapons with silver, while at the same time the final bio Plains is stupidly hard and almost impossible to solo legitimately

So fun game but you run out of content quickly. Thankfully the devs are working on adding a ton more content and i think the game is only going to get better
